/* Hive Skirmish */
* Hive skirmishes are intense and exciting battles versus the ever expanding 'Hive' in Serco, Itani, and greyspace. Hive skirmishes become available at Combat level 3, are categorized according to their size and relative difficulty.
A ''Small Skirmish'' involves few ships, usually between 10 and 30
A ''Common Skirmish'' is similar to a small skirmish with more ships, up to 50 or more
A ''Critical Skirmish'' involves a friendly capital ship, many fighters, and one primary target: an enemy Hive Queen
A ''Central Skirmish'' is a huge battle versus multiple queens and the greatest of all Hive threats: the Leviathan
When a Hive Skirmish is taken in a sector with an ion storm, monetary and xp rewards are quadrupled, making this special subset of missions highly profitable.
In all Hive Skirmishes players are grouped together with a friendly team and given an objective such as killing the Hive Queen or a certain number of Hive bots before a given number of friendly ships are killed. As fighter ships from both sides are destroyed they are reinforced as more fighters warp into the combat sector and join the skirmish. Players who accept Hive Skirmish missions to the same sector are automatically grouped. The Leviathan and Hive Queens are protected by shields which are strengthened by the number of sectors their respective Hives control, therefore it is wise to take the smaller missions first before working up to the critical and central skirmishes.
* Three different Hives may be found in the galaxy:
The ''Seipos Hive'' is centered in Rhamus, and expands into Initros and Dantia
The ''Prosus Hive'' is centered in Metana, and expands into Cantus and Setalli Shinas
The ''Milanar Hive'' is centered in Sedina, and expands into Odia and Latos
Each Hive carries unique drops, which may be used to craft items at the conquerable stations.
* A useful tactic if the skirmishes become too difficult is to turbo away from the center of battle until a safe distance is reached, and allowing the Hive bots to approach one or two at a time. Also, remember to plot an escape nav route before entering the combat sector in case you need to leave in a hurry, and home nearby.
